9/2/2008- Ten Least Expensive Vehicles to Insure 2008 Jeep Patriot 2008 Pontiac Vibe 2008 Mazda 5 2008 Chrysler PT Cruiser 2008 Scion xB 2008 Jeep Compass 2008 Chevrolet Uplander 2008 Pontiac Torrent 2008 Jeep Wrangler 2008 Mazda Tribute What makes one vehicle more expensive than another? Companies base rates on their individual loss history with a certain type of car. Cost to repair, likelyhood of theft and safety features are also considered.

5/1/2008- Alternative Vehicles 4 dollars a gallon???? Its time to seriously consider other options. Introducing SMART CARS. Smart cars are 3 cylinder, 1 liter gas powered engine vehicles. They are licensed for road use and include airbags and antilock brakes. Visit Smart Cars Other emerging tiny electric vehicles include GEM ( Global Electric Motorcars ), ZAP ( Zero Air Pollution), NEV ( Neighborhood Electric Vehicles ), and LSV (Low speed vehicles). They are more environmentally friendly vehicles but don’t have safety equipment yet. While the electric type vehicles have been around for a few years, the SMART cars are just now being imported. Since these vehicles do not have VIN numbers, it will be a while before they are integrated into our standard registering and insuring process. A new body style (mini subcompact) will be established for these vehicles. The insurance rates for these vehicles will be volatile until companies can determine proper pricing based on loss experience.
4/2/2008- When during the home buying process should I purchase Homeowners Insurance? We can place insurance as quickly as the day before closing. However, I recommend three weeks prior to the closing date. This gives the mortgage company sufficient time to review the policy. It also allows your Insurance company to preform their home inspections. The insurance inspections can be done AFTER closing, but it helps having the inspection results prior to closing day. This gives you further negotiation power with the seller should something arise during the insurance inspection.
3/25/2008- Vacant Houses There is a major difference between a "vacant house" and an "unoccupied house." A vacant house is completely empty. An unoccupied home is furnished but without a current resident. Maybe the homeowner went on vacation for the summer. This home would be unoccupied for the time. Most insurance companies shy from covering vacant houses. Vacant homes have a high propensity for vandalism, and or squatters. If you have a vacant house that needs insurance, I do have a policy available through NY State. The coverages are limited and the state requires that the windows are boarded. 3/17/2008- Gold Hits $1000 per ounce. Look out for Burglaries With the value of the dollar declining and oil prices increasing, investors are looking elsewhere. This has lead to the value of gold skyrocketing to almost $1000 per ounce. Historically, when the gold prices increase, the insurance industry sees increases in burglaries. Thieves break into homes specifically looking for gold knowing they can pawn it for record profits. It is important to know that homeowners insurance usually caps jewelry claims at $1000 per claim. If you have jewelry in excess of this amount, speak with your insurance agent or broker for additional options.

2/21/2008- Underground Oil Tanks If you have an underground oil tank leak in Rockland County, you must immediately call the Spills Hot Line at 1-800-457-7362. Pay extra attention when purchasing a home with an underground oil tank. Spills are expensive to clean and create large liability issues for the homeowners. As oil tanks age they may rust and leak. When purchasing a home, have a qualified inspector evaluate the tank and soil around the tank. In Rockland County try Frank Libero.. After purchasing the house, monitor the grounds regularly for any unusual smells or dry spots. This could be the first sign of a spill. If you home is using more than a normal amount of oil, it may be leaking as well. In the long run, it will be less expensive to replace the underground tank prior to leakage with a new above ground tank. For more information, visit the environmental protection agency.

2/15/2008- Lock in your Flood Insurance Tis the season to purchase flood insurance. With Spring right around the corner, and April Showers approaching, its time to lock in your coverage. Unless a mortgage company requires flood insurance for the loan, there is a 30-day waiting period before the policy becomes effective. So purchasing the insurance now will ensure its availability for the rainy seasons. Flood Insurance is strictly regulated by the Federal Government. visit fema. 2/8/2008- Insure your Valentine's Day Gifts There is one very special person you should keep in mind this Valentine’s day. Your insurance Agent! You should discuss proper insurance for any jewelry or electronics that you purchase for your loved ones. Jewlery is a Valentine’s day specialty. Provide the receipt as well as any appraisals to your insurance broker. Consider taking pictures and saving them to a cyber inventory system Standard homeowners and renters insurance policies include coverage for jewelry and other valuable items such as furs. However, many policies limit the dollar amount of coverage for the theft, or loss due to a covered peril, of such items—the limit is usually $1,000. To properly insure jewelry and other expensive items, consider scheduling them as a floater to your existing homeowners insurance This can eliminate the deductible and extend coverages to an all risk basis. Including Misplacement. Prices for floaters and endorsements will vary depending on the type of jewelry and where the items are kept. In addition to jewelry, floaters are also available for furs, fine art, musical instruments and golf equipment. 2/5/2008- Registering a Vehicle in New York You will first need to set up valid auto insurance. Click here for Rockland County auto insurance quotes. Bring the auto insurance identification card, proof of identification indicating your date of birth, along with valid proof of ownership (vehicle title) to the department of motor vehicles. If the vehicle is 8 model years old or newer, make sure the seller completes the Odometer and Damage Disclosure Statements on the back of the title. Rockland County DMV is located at 50 Samsondale Plaza Rt. 9W W. Haverstraw, NY 10993. You can save time at the DMV by filling out Vehicle Registration Form. prior to arriving. 1/8/2008- Should I buy insurance from a car rental company when I rent a vehicle? Usually not. Your primary car insurance extends to cars that you borrow or rent. So dont feel pressured into buying additional coverage for high daily prices unless you are traveling abroad. (Coverages are limited to the U.S.) Keep in mind your insurance will only extend coverages that you currently have. So if you have LIABILITY ONLY on your car insurance, you should purchase comp and collision from the rental company. If you have FULL COVERAGE on your every day vehicle that should be adequate. Just remember to bring a current id card to the dealership. Also remember to pay your car insurance before going on vacation. Someone was once smart enough to waive the rental insurance but since she was away, she didnt get her insurance bill and her primary coverage cancelled for non-payment. 12/12/2007- Holiday Home Safety It’s the most wonderful time of the year. It could also be the most dangerous. Some First time homeowners, excited about first time holiday decorating; fail to plan for holiday safety. There are an estimated 200 fires and 25 injuries resulting from Christmas tree fires each year. You can easily prevent most incidents---- Ensure that whichever room contains the Christmas tree also has a smoke detector--- While putting on the ornaments, it is also a good time to check the detector’s batteries.--- Do not place your tree near a heat source, including fireplaces or heat vents. The heat can ignite, and cause flames or sparks.--- Cut the bottom two inches of the tree for better water absorption. This will preserve the life of the tree.--- Remember nightly to check the tree for water.--- Never put Christmas tree branches or needles in a fireplace or wood-burning stove.--- Never burn wrapping paper in the fireplace. (Or any colored paper)--- Do not allow the tree to remain in the home long after it dries out.--- Inspect holiday lights each year for frayed wire, bare spots, gaps in the insulation, broken or cracked sockets, and excessive kinking or wear.--- In homes with toddlers or rebellious puppies do not hang flashy or glass ornaments towards the bottom of the tree.--- Only use UL-approved lighting. (Will be indicated on packaging)--- Keep indoor lights INDOORS--- Do not overload outlets. Connect strings of lights to an extension cord before plugging the cord into the outlet.---
